MSF in Sierra Leone
IAR 2007: Sierra Leone: Why we are here
MSF-supported health centres treated more than 100,000 cases of malaria. © Ake Ericson
Sierra Leone is one of the poorest countries in the world and even low patient fees deter people from seeking treatment.
